Standard Specification for Nickel Rod and Bar
The following bibliographic material is provided to assist you with your purchasing decision:
This specification covers nickel (UNS N02200), low carbon nickel (UNS N02201), and solution strengthened nickel (UNS N02211) in the form of hot-worked, cold-worked, or annealed rods and bars of round, square, hexagonal, or rectangular solid section. The material shall conform to the chemical composition limits specified for nickel, copper, iron, manganese, carbon, silicon, and sulfur. Mechanical requirements including tensile strength, yield strength, and elongation are given for specific conditions and diameter or distance between parallel surfaces. Chemical analysis, tension test, and hardness test shall be performed.
Scope
1.1 This specification covers nickel (UNS N02200)*, low carbon nickel (UNS N02201)*, and solution strengthened nickel (UNS N02211) in the form of hot-worked and cold-worked rod and bar in the conditions shown in Table 1.
1.2 The values stated in inch-pound units are to be regarded as standard. The values given in parentheses are mathematical conversions to SI units that are provided for information only and are not considered standard.

TABLE 1 Mechanical Properties
Condition and Diameter or Distance Between Parallel Surfaces, in. (mm) | Tensile Strength, min, psi (MPa) | Yield Strength (0.2 % offset), min. psi (MPa)A | Elongation in 2 in. or 50 mm or 4D, min % |
---|---|---|---|
Nickel (UNS N02200) | |||
Cold-worked (as worked): | |||
Rounds, 1 (25.4) and under | 80 000 (550) | 60 000 (415) | 10B |
Rounds over 1 to 4 (25.4 to 101.6) incl. | 75 000 (515) | 50 000 (345) | 15 |
Squares, hexagons, and rectangles, all sizes | 65 000 (450) | 40 000 (275) | 25B |
Hot-worked: | |||
All sections, all sizes | 60 000 (415) | 15 000 (105) | 35C |
Rings and disksD | — | — | — |
Annealed: | |||
Rods and bars, all sizes | 55 000 (380) | 15 000 (105) | 40B |
Rings and disksE | — | — | — |
Forging quality | |||
All sizes | F | F | F |
Low-Carbon Nickel (UNS N02201) and Solution Strengthened Nickel (UNS N02211) | |||
Hot-worked: | |||
All sections, all sizes | 50 000 (345) | 10 000 (70) | 40C |
Annealed: | |||
All products, all sizes | 50 000 (345) | 10 000 (70) | 40B |
A See 12.2.
B Not applicable to diameters or cross sections under 3/32 in. (2.4 mm).
C For hot-worked flats 5/16 in. (7.9 mm) and under in thickness the elongation shall be 25%, min.
D Hardness B45 to B80, or equivalent.
E Hardness B45 to B70 or equivalent.
F Forging quality is furnished to chemical requirements and surface inspection only. No tensile properties are required.
